Smart greenhouse is the future development direction

Jul 14, 2021

Smart greenhouse technology combines the Internet of Things technology, modern advanced science and technology, resource integration technology and energy regeneration, using shadowless glass technology, soilless cultivation technology, RFID technology, photovoltaic power generation technology, picking robot technology, intelligent classification technology, Intelligent sprinkler irrigation technology and advanced Internet of Things system technology can realize the integrated and automatic work from seed selection, planting, irrigation, fertilization, environmental control, harvesting, packaging, transportation, storage and sales.

core function

 

1. Automatic monitoring:

The growth of crops has very high environmental requirements, and many parameters need to be monitored. If any parameter is unqualified, it may have a very important impact on yield. Through the automatic monitoring and control of intelligent equipment, it is possible to have an accurate and timely grasp of environmental parameters, which is an important manifestation of the degree of intelligence of the intelligent greenhouse.

2. Energy saving:

Energy conservation is an important indicator in any industry, and modern technology also attaches great importance to energy regeneration and environmental protection. Smart greenhouses are particularly effective in energy saving and convenience. Solar collectors are used to meet the demand for thermal energy in the greenhouse; solar panels and amorphous silicon solar cells are used to convert electrical energy to meet the electrical energy required for equipment control in the greenhouse.

3. Intelligent irrigation:

Intelligent irrigation (drip irrigation and sprinkler irrigation) technology is the main function of intelligent greenhouse irrigation. The intelligent sprinkler irrigation technology of intelligent greenhouses is divided into drip irrigation and sprinkler irrigation. Drip irrigation can not only realize the watering function, but also mix fertilizer and water to achieve the purpose of uniform fertilization. . Intelligent sprinkler irrigation technology can control the speed of sprinkler irrigation and the size of spray water, as well as realize regional control and regional irrigation functions. It plays a very important role in the water retention of the entire greenhouse.

4. RFID technology:

Binding each traceable chip to the plant, when intelligent classification, by calling the plant growth environment information stored on the chip or the current product information (such as fruit size, flower color, etc.) to combine different information Plants or products are separated; and the information monitored on the chip can be integrated into a barcode or two-dimensional code. When purchasing a product, users can directly scan the code with their mobile phone to see the plant or product growth process and post-picking information. Let consumers rest assured to buy.
